Arithmetic Geometric Model for Bi-Critical Irrationally Indifferent Attractors

par Jocelyn Russell (Londres)

Description

Holomorphic maps that have fixed points with multiplier equal to an irrational rotation exhibit complicated and rich long term behaviour. The development of the Inou-Shishikura class led authors such as Cheraghi to study critical orbits via a special non-holomorphic toy model which retains important topological and geometrical properties, while depending only on arithmetic features. In this talk I will introduce a new toy model for the bi-critical case, for which the extra critical point introduces more complexity.
